Merge pull request #2819 from BrzVlad/fix-major-log
[mono.git] / external / android-libunwind / include / libunwind.h
1 /* Provide a real file - not a symlink - as it would cause multiarch conflicts
2    when multiple different arch releases are installed simultaneously.  */
3
4 #ifndef UNW_REMOTE_ONLY
5
6 #if defined __aarch64__
7 #include "libunwind-aarch64.h"
8 #elif defined __arm__
9 # include "libunwind-arm.h"
10 #elif defined __hppa__
11 # include "libunwind-hppa.h"
12 #elif defined __ia64__
13 # include "libunwind-ia64.h"
14 #elif defined __mips__
15 # include "libunwind-mips.h"
16 #elif defined __powerpc__ && !defined __powerpc64__
17 # include "libunwind-ppc32.h"
18 #elif defined __powerpc64__
19 # include "libunwind-ppc64.h"
20 #elif defined __sh__
21 # include "libunwind-sh.h"
22 #elif defined __i386__
23 # include "libunwind-x86.h"
24 #elif defined __x86_64__
25 # include "libunwind-x86_64.h"
26 #else
27 # error "Unsupported arch"
28 #endif
29
30 #else /* UNW_REMOTE_ONLY */
31
32 # include "libunwind-arm.h"
33
34 #endif /* UNW_REMOTE_ONLY */